Method: alerts.batchDelete

Führt für Batch-Löschvorgänge für Benachrichtigungen aus.

HTTP-Anfrage

POST https://alertcenter.googleapis.com/v1beta1/alerts:batchDelete

Die URL verwendet die Syntax der gRPC-Transcodierung.

Anfragetext

Der Anfragetext enthält Daten mit folgender Struktur:

JSON-Darstellung
{
  "customerId": string,
  "alertId": [
    string
  ]
}
Felder
customerId

string

Optional. Die eindeutige Kennung des Google Workspace-Kontos des Kunden, mit dem die Benachrichtigungen verknüpft sind. Beim customerId muss das Anfangsbuchstaben „C“ entfernt werden, z. B. 046psxkn. Es wird von der Anruferidentität abgeleitet, sofern nicht angegeben. Kundennummer ermitteln

alertId[]

string

Erforderlich. Die Liste der zu löschenden Benachrichtigungs-IDs.

Antworttext

Antwort auf einen Batch-Löschvorgang für Benachrichtigungen.

Bei Erfolg enthält der Antworttext Daten mit der folgenden Struktur:

JSON-Darstellung
{
  "successAlertIds": [
    string
  ],
  "failedAlertStatus": {
    string: {
      object (google.rpc.Status)
    },
    ...
  }
}
Felder
successAlertIds[]

string

Die erfolgreiche Liste von Benachrichtigungs-IDs.

failedAlertStatus

map (key: string, value: object (google.rpc.Status))

Die Statusdetails für jedes fehlgeschlagene alertId.

Autorisierungsbereiche

Erfordert den folgenden OAuth-Bereich:

  • https://www.googleapis.com/auth/apps.alerts

Weitere Informationen finden Sie im Leitfaden zur Autorisierung.